https://www.freestock.com//free-photos/vedra-island-ibiza-spain-780139885https://www.freestock.com/legalhttps://www.freestock.com//free-photos/vedra-island-ibiza-spain-780139885<a href="https://www.freestock.com//free-photos/vedra-island-ibiza-spain-780139885">Image used under license from Freestock.com</a>Freestock.comtruetrue